Natasha Estrada
Skeleton placeholder

Natasha Estrada

actress

writer

director

Known For

arrowarrow
Back to the News: No News is Good News
Skeleton placeholder
Your Mom
Skeleton placeholder
Frankly a Mess
Skeleton placeholder
Catspiration
Skeleton placeholder

Filmography